Everything You Should Know Before Moving to Powder River, WY

Considering a move to Powder River, WY? With a tiny population of just 30 residents, Powder River offers rural living, affordable home prices around $130,000, and low average rents. Commutes average 33 minutes, and the cost of living sits below national averages. You'll enjoy 67% sunny days each year and easy access to the outdoors, though educational and healthcare options are limited—major services are in nearby Casper. If you value quiet, wide open spaces, and a tight-knit community, Powder River is a uniquely peaceful place to call home.

What is the weather like in Powder River, WY year-round?

Residents of Powder River enjoy a climate with cold winters—lows often near 9°F—and warm summers reaching up to 86°F. The area receives about 13.7 inches of rainfall annually and sees sunshine 67% of the year. This weather is ideal for those who appreciate four distinct seasons and plenty of sunny days.

How are the schools in Powder River, WY?

Educational opportunities in Powder River are limited locally, with Midwest School serving the area for K–12 students and a low student-teacher ratio. For higher education, residents typically commute to Casper College, located 41 miles away in Casper. The town’s small size means families may need to travel for broader academic options.

What is the housing market like in Powder River, WY?

The housing market in Powder River is stable and highly affordable, with a median home price of $130,000 and an average two-bedroom rent of $800. Homeownership is common, with 82% of residents owning their homes, and the market sees modest appreciation. Rental vacancies are low, reflecting steady housing demand despite the town's small size.
